Seremban Line (Kuala Lumpur Trams)
The first stop of the Seremban Line tram route is Pulau Sebang (Tampin) and the last stop is Batu Caves. Seremban Line (KTM Batu Caves - Pulau Sebang/Tampin) is operational during everyday.
Additional information: Seremban Line has 27 stops and the total trip duration for this route is approximately 200 minutes.
